  7. dalchina New Member
    There are other 3rd party Win 10 -ish start menus around with tiles.

    Bear in mind Win 10's start menu is comparatively difficult to work with (Where's Startup? No drag 'n drop, left column) and it fails badly on complex start menus with sub-sub folders when the contents of the typical folder created by a program are extracted and listed alphabetically.

    Thus I see
    Help
    Help
    Help
    Help

    - where each one actually relates to a different program.

    Classic shell is problem free, comfortable, quite configurable, can launch apps as well as programs, and has a better and more configurable search bar.

    And you can still launch Win 10's native start menu with a hot key.
    Windows 10 Start menu replacements shifting like hot cakes • The Register

    You could try
    Start10: Software from Stardock Corporation
    (traditional and tiled options)
